Mia Khalifa Reacts to Lebanon Strikes
Mia Khalifa voiced concern over the reported scale of destruction across Lebanon, highlighting the intensity of attacks that allegedly included 160 air strikes within just ten minutes. She pointed to reports that residential buildings and schools were hit, displacing thousands of civilians, while hospitals were also targeted, severely affecting the region's ability to treat the injured. Khalifa also expressed shock over strikes reportedly impacting cemeteries and funeral gatherings, calling attention to the humanitarian toll as civilians mourned their losses. Her remarks came amid ongoing international discussions around a possible ceasefire, further underscoring the urgency of the situation and the growing concern over civilian safety.
Mia Khalifa Gets Emotional Over Lebanon
For Khalifa, the crisis is deeply personal. She expressed a painful internal conflict regarding her role as a taxpayer in the West, noting her distress that her own tax dollars are being used to fund military actions against the region she calls home. "We've watched a genocide play out before our eyes for decades," she stated, adding that the intensity has surged to "insane" levels in recent years. During the address, Khalifa suffered a visible emotional breakdown, admitting that despite her fortunate circumstances abroad, the sense of helplessness is overwhelming.

Mia Khalifa's Controversial Statement
The most provocative portion of Khalifa's message came in the video's caption, where she levelled serious accusations against the United States and Israel. She categorised the military actions as terrorism and labelled both nations as fascist states. "This is nothing less than TERRORISM enacted by two countries whose war crimes go bar for bar," she wrote. "America and Israel are terrorist, fascist states with trials at The Hague waiting for both of them one day." As the international community debates the next steps in the region, Khalifa's plea ends with a haunting question shared by many, "When will it stop?"
